Key Features of the IRA Application Form
The IRA Application Form comprises several vital components, ensuring comprehensive information capture:
-
Personal information section including the IRA Owner's name and address.
-
Beneficiary designation options for future financial security.
-
Investment instructions guiding the account management choices.
-
Spousal consent requirements, ensuring that spouses are involved in the process.
-
An arbitration provision, outlining conflict resolution procedures.

Common Errors and Solutions When Filling Out the IRA Application Form
Errors in completing the IRA Application Form can lead to delays or complications. Common mistakes include:
-
Omitting critical personal information.
-
Failing to designate beneficiaries correctly.
-
Neglecting spousal consent or signatures.
To avoid these issues, double-check all entries and ensure that all required fields are completed accurately, particularly those that relate to personal identification and consent.

Who is eligible to fill out the IRA Application Form?
Individuals legally permitted to open an Individual Retirement Account (IRA) are eligible to fill out this form. Spousal consent may also be required for married IRA owners.
What documents do I need to submit with the form?
Typically, you'll need personal identification documents such as your Social Security Number, as well as information about beneficiaries. Ensure you have everything ready before starting the application.
How do I submit the completed IRA Application Form?
The form can be submitted directly through pdfFiller if your submission method is enabled, or you can download it and send it via mail or email according to your financial institution's guidelines.
Can I e-sign the IRA Application Form?
Yes, if you're using pdfFiller, it allows for electronic signatures. Ensure that you and your spouse have signed where required before finalizing the submission.
What is the processing time for the IRA Application Form?
Processing times for IRA applications can vary by institution. Generally, it may take several business days to a few weeks to process your application after submission.
What are common mistakes to avoid when filling out this form?
Common mistakes include incomplete fields, inaccurate personal information, and failing to obtain spousal consent when applicable. Ensure you review the form thoroughly prior to submission.
